Sound and picture not in sync (Sony player and TV)

My parents have a Sony Blu Ray player S350 hooked up by HDMI to a 42" Sony 1080 HDTV (sorry I don't know the exact model). The audio is out of sync with the video. It's intermitten, but it happens when playing Blu discs (standard DVD's have no sync issue). I haven't gone HD yet so I don't know much. Is there an easy way to trouble shoot this? Is there a simple sync adjustment on Blu Ray that I should know about?

Re: Sound and picture not in sync (Sony player and TV)

Does it have the latest firmware? Is it just the TV or is this with an audio system?

Many BDp's have had A/V sync issues. But Sony should be ok from this, if you have the latest firmware. I think. Maybe you should look up the owner's thread at AVS, it will have covered this if it is a typical issue.
